The Broadwater County Museum is located in Townsend, Montana. Established in 1971, it features a variety of exhibits that tell the story of early life in Montana. There are also numerous outdoor activities and scenic vistas to enjoy along with your visit. The McCormicks Livery and Feed Stable is a historical site located in Townsend, Montana. The livery was established in 1885 and operated until 1915. The building has been preserved and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.

How much does it cost to rent an RV in Townsend?Motorhomes are divided into Class A, B, and C vehicles. On average expect to pay $185 per night for Class A, $149 per night for Class B and $179 per night for Class C. Towable RVs include 5th Wheel, Travel Trailers, Popups, and Toy Hauler. On average, in Townsend, MT, the 5th Wheel trailer starts at $70 per night. Pricing for the Travel Trailer begins at $60 per night, and the Popup Trailer starts at $65 per night.
